Block 630,069
Block Hash
22593e32e06b00984d87fc434087236cdb35232f2638b8595b39c70ee97ca48c
Previous Block Hash
710b1fdabf39463ff6acee7d8c53d48531ac856918aaefbd895b6cec67d0b0ae
Mined
Transactions
4
Difficulty
51.61 M
Size
814 bytes
Transactions (4)
1 input, 1 output
10,000.00645001
PEPE
1 input, 1 output
196,754.07750761
PEPE
1 input, 2 outputs
90,646.90742
PEPE
1 input, 2 outputs
90,645.90516
PEPE